AUVON's 7-day AM/PM organizer uses two rows of compartments — morning and evening — for the same daily slot. The snap-close lids require just a fingertip of pressure to open, making them accessible for people with arthritis or limited hand strength. The compartments hold 8-10 standard tablets per slot. The BPA-free plastic is odorless and does not impart taste to pills stored over the week. The entire organizer fits in a drawer or medicine cabinet without taking up excessive space. MEDca's extra large compartment organizer uses single-slot-per-day design with maximum compartment volume — the largest available in budget organizers. Better for people taking extended-release capsules, large omega-3 softgels, or fish oil capsules that do not fit in standard AM/PM slots. Single-dose design works if all pills are taken at once rather than split between morning and evening.
